Shared vendors 6 canonical vendors paid by both committees
| Vendor | ADVANCING FREEDOM FUND paid | NICHOLSON FOR SENATE paid | Combined | Active | Tx count |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| USPS | $1,290 | $120,703 | $121,993 | 2017–2018 | 2 + 52 |
| WASHINGTON INTELLIGENCE BUREAU | $3,899 | $106,959 | $110,858 | 2017–2018 | 10 + 41 |
| THE PROSPER GROUP | $31,052 | $66,149 | $97,201 | 2017–2019 | 1 + 17 |
| THE GOBER GROUP PLLC | $1,000 | $51,616 | $52,616 | 2017–2022 | 1 + 8 |
| RIGHTSIDE COMPLIANCE | $28,747 | $3,858 | $32,605 | 2017–2022 | 15 + 1 |
| FIRST VIRGINIA COMMUNITY BANK | $380 | $3,228 | $3,608 | 2017–2018 | 8 + 6 |
